How’s this for a hand built AAA MiniMag Mod? RufusBDuck outdid himself with this one, from it’s totally custom made driver (12mm in diameter) putting out 1.11A on high to the copper fins he made from scratch, this little beauty performs! TexasPyro tested it in his Sphere and it measured out at 261 lumens on Hi, 84 in Med, and 15 in Lo. The XP-G2 emitter that I reflowed onto a copper SinkPAD and turned down to 11mm for RBD is tested at 5533K in Hi mode. Nice white light with a solid beam, no hotspot, courtesy of a Ledil Tina2-D Optic. Couldn’t be any prouder! Look at how it dares face off the Solarforce S2200! lol

This shot is 40 individual images at some 11MB ea stacked into the one you see above. :slight_smile:
